בדף הזה מתוארים הדגלים של מסד הנתונים שבהם AlloyDB ל-PostgreSQL משתמש כדי להפעיל ולנהל תכונות שירות שייחודיות ל-AlloyDB. רשימה של כל הדגלים של מסדי הנתונים שנתמכים ב-AlloyDB מופיעה במאמר בנושא דגלים של מסדי נתונים נתמכים.
משמעות הדגלים שמסומנים בהפעלה מחדש של מופע היא ש-AlloyDB מפעיל מחדש מופע בכל פעם שמגדירים, מסירים או משנים את הדגל הזה במופע. ערך הדגל נשמר במופע עד שמשנים אותו שוב.
alloydb.audit_log_line_prefix
| סוג | string |
| ברירת מחדל | "%m [%p]: [%l-1] db=%d,user=%u |
| הפעלה מחדש של מכונה | כן |
המידע של אמצעי הבקרה מופיע בתחילת כל שורה ביומן הביקורת. אם לא מציינים קידומת, לא נעשה שימוש בקידומת.
alloydb.enable_pgaudit
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
המדיניות הזו קובעת את הזמינות של התוסף pgaudit במופע AlloyDB. מגדירים את הפרמטר לערך on ומפעילים מחדש את המכונה. לאחר מכן מוסיפים את התוסף pgaudit למסדי נתונים ספציפיים במכונה באמצעות הפקודה CREATE
EXTENSION.
התוסף pgaudit מספק רישום מפורט ביומן הביקורת של סשנים ואובייקטים באמצעות מתקן הרישום הסטנדרטי שסופק על ידי PostgreSQL.
alloydb.enable_auto_explain
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
הפרמטר הזה קובע את הזמינות של התוסף auto_explain במכונת AlloyDB. מגדירים את הפרמטר לערך on ומפעילים מחדש את המכונה.
התוסף auto_explain מאפשר רישום אוטומטי ביומן של תוכניות ביצוע של הצהרות איטיות, לצורך פתרון בעיות ועוד. הוא מספק דרך אוטומטית לבצע את הפונקציונליות של הפקודה EXPLAIN.
alloydb.enable_pg_bigm
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
המדיניות הזו קובעת את הזמינות של התוסף pg_bigm במופע AlloyDB. מגדירים את הפרמטר לערך on ומפעילים מחדש את המכונה. לאחר מכן מוסיפים את התוסף pg_bigm למסדי נתונים ספציפיים במכונה באמצעות הפקודה CREATE
EXTENSION.
התוסף pg_bigm מספק יכולת חיפוש טקסט מלא ב-PostgreSQL באמצעות אינדקסים של 2-גרם (ביגרם) לחיפושים מהירים יותר של טקסט מלא.
alloydb.enable_pg_cron
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
המדיניות הזו קובעת את הזמינות של התוסף pg_cron במופע AlloyDB. מגדירים את הפרמטר לערך on ומפעילים מחדש את המכונה. לאחר מכן מוסיפים את התוסף pg_cron למסדי נתונים ספציפיים במכונה באמצעות הפקודה CREATE
EXTENSION.
התוסף pg_cron מספק מתזמן משימות מבוסס-cron ל-PostgreSQL שפועל בתוך מסד הנתונים כתוסף. התחביר שלו זהה לזה של cron רגיל, והוא מאפשר לתזמן פקודות PostgreSQL ישירות ממסד הנתונים.
alloydb.enable_pg_hint_plan
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
המדיניות הזו קובעת את הזמינות של התוסף pg_hint_plan במופע AlloyDB. מגדירים את הפרמטר בתור on ומפעילים מחדש את המכונה. לאחר מכן מוסיפים את התוסף pg_hint_plan למסדי נתונים ספציפיים במופע באמצעות הפקודה CREATE EXTENSION.
התוסף pg_hint_plan מאפשר לשפר את תוכניות ההפעלה של PostgreSQL באמצעות רמזים, שהם תיאורים בתגובות SQL.
alloydb.enable_pg_wait_sampling
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
הפרמטר מאפשר ל-AlloyDB לאסוף נתונים סטטיסטיים של דגימה של אירועי המתנה.
מגדירים את הפרמטר לערך on ומפעילים מחדש את המופע. לאחר מכן, מוסיפים את התוסף pg_wait_sampling למסדי נתונים ספציפיים במופע באמצעות הפקודה CREATE EXTENSION.
התוסף pg_wait_sampling צובר ומסכם את נתוני אירועי ההמתנה. אפשר להריץ שאילתות על התצוגות האלה כדי לקבל תובנות לגבי זמני ההמתנה, התדירויות והחשיבות היחסית של אירועי המתנה שונים.
alloydb.enable_pglogical
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
הפרמטר הזה קובע אם התוסף pglogical זמין במופע AlloyDB. מגדירים את הפרמטר לערך on ומפעילים מחדש את המופע. לאחר מכן מוסיפים את התוסף pglogical למסדי נתונים ספציפיים במופע באמצעות הפקודה CREATE EXTENSION.
התוסף pglogical מספק שכפול לוגי של סטרימינג ל-PostgreSQL באמצעות מודל שמבוסס על פרסום והרשמה.
alloydb.iam_authentication
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
מאפשר להשתמש באימות של ניהול זהויות והרשאות גישה (IAM) במופע AlloyDB.
alloydb.logical_decoding
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
הפעלת התשתית של פענוח לוגי של PostgreSQL במכונת AlloyDB.
פענוח לוגי מספק את התשתית שנדרשת להזרמת שינויים בנתונים לצרכנים חיצוניים.
alloydb.log_throttling_window
| סוג | integer |
| ברירת מחדל | 0 |
| הפעלה מחדש של מכונה | לא |
ההגדרה הזו קובעת אם AlloyDB יתעד הודעות יומן כפולות שהתקבלו במהלך חלון זמן מוגדר.
אם הערך שמוגדר גדול מ-0, מערכת AlloyDB מפעילה טיימר באורך של מספר השניות הזה בכל פעם שהיא מתעדת הודעת יומן. אם מערכת AlloyDB מקבלת את אותה הודעת יומן לפני שהטיימר מסתיים, היא לא מתעדת את ההודעה. אחרי שהטיימר מסתיים, מערכת AlloyDB מוסיפה ספירה של הודעות שדילגה עליהן להופעה הבאה של אותה הודעת יומן שהיא מתעדת.
אם הערך שמוגדר הוא 0, AlloyDB מתעד את כל ההודעות הכפולות ביומן.
alloydb.promote_cancel_to_terminate
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| לא |
אם הערך מוגדר ל-true, כל בקשה לביטול שאילתה בגלל בעיות כמו פסק זמן של נעילה, פסק זמן של הצהרה ועימותים של שחזור (הפעלה חוזרת) שמתרחשים ב-AlloyDB, מקודמת לבקשות סיום מאולצות של קצה העורפי.
קידום בקשות הביטול עוזר ל-AlloyDB למנוע ממערכות קצה תקועות לחסום הפעלה חוזרת של יומנים ומערכות קצה אחרות.
alloydb.pg_shadow_select_role
| סוג | string |
| ברירת מחדל | מחרוזת ריקה |
| הפעלה מחדש של מכונה | לא |
שם התפקיד ב-PostgreSQL שבו ישתמשו כדי לתת הרשאה להריץ שאילתות בתצוגה pg_shadow.
alloydb_password
| סוג | string |
| ברירת מחדל | מחרוזת ריקה |
| הפעלה מחדש של מכונה | לא |
השירות הזה מספק פונקציות להגדרה ולניהול של מדיניות סיסמאות ב-AlloyDB Omni. אם משתמשי מסד הנתונים של האפליקציה מאומתים באמצעות AlloyDB Omni בשיטה המובנית שמבוססת על סיסמה, אתם יכולים לחייב שימוש בסיסמאות חזקות כדי להפוך את האימות למאובטח יותר.
מידע נוסף זמין במאמר ניהול אימות מובנה באמצעות מדיניות סיסמאות.
alloydb_scann
| סוג | string |
| ברירת מחדל | מחרוזת ריקה |
| הפעלה מחדש של מכונה | לא |
התוסף מספק פונקציות שמאפשרות ל-AlloyDB Omni לטפל בעומסי עבודה של חיפוש וקטורי עם ביצועים ויעילות גבוהים.
מידע נוסף מופיע במאמר בנושא יצירת אינדקסים ושאילתות של וקטורים.
alloydb_ai_nl
| סוג | string |
| ברירת מחדל | מחרוזת ריקה |
| הפעלה מחדש של מכונה | לא |
מספק פונקציות שמאפשרות לשאול שאילתות ב-AlloyDB בצורה מאובטחת באמצעות שפה טבעית. התוסף פועל יחד עם התוסף parameterized_views`, שמחיל שכבת אבטחה על הנתונים.
מידע נוסף זמין במאמר בנושא יצירת שאילתות SQL באמצעות שפה טבעית.
parameterized_views
| סוג | string |
| ברירת מחדל | מחרוזת ריקה |
| הפעלה מחדש של מכונה | לא |
מספק פונקציות שמוסיפות שכבת אבטחה כששאילתות בשפה טבעית מתורגמות לשאילתות SQL. התוסף הזה פועל יחד עם התוסף alloydb_ai_nl.
מידע נוסף זמין במאמר בנושא יצירת שאילתות SQL באמצעות שפה טבעית.
alloydb_ai_nl.enabled
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
המדיניות הזו קובעת אם תכונות השפה הטבעית של AlloyDB AI מופעלות.
scann.enable_preview_features
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
ההרשאה מאפשרת להשתמש בתכונות הבאות שזמינות בגרסת טרום-השקה:
* תחזוקת אינדקס אוטומטית – המערכת מנהלת את האינדקס באופן מצטבר, כך שכאשר מערך הנתונים גדל, AlloyDB Omni מפצלת מחיצות גדולות של חריגים ומנסה לספק QPS טוב יותר ותוצאות חיפוש טובות יותר. * יצירת אינדקס מושהית: יצירת האינדקס מושהית לשורות ריקות או לטבלאות עם מספר שורות לא מספיק. * אינדקסים של עצים עם ארבע רמות תומכים בטבלאות עם יותר ממיליארד שורות של וקטורים.scann.enable_index_maintenance
| סוג | boolean |
| ברירת מחדל | on |
| הפעלה מחדש של מכונה | כן |
המדיניות הזו קובעת אם התכונות של תחזוקה אוטומטית של אינדקס וקטורי מופעלות.
scann.max_background_workers
| סוג | integer |
| ברירת מחדל | 1 |
| הפעלה מחדש של מכונה | כן |
ההגדרה קובעת את מספר העובדים ברקע שמשמשים לתחזוקה אוטומטית של אינדקס וקטורי. מידע נוסף זמין במאמר בנושא הגדלת נפח הנתונים של התחזוקה האוטומטית.
scann.maintenance_background_naptime_s
| סוג | integer |
| ברירת מחדל | 1 |
| הפעלה מחדש של מכונה | כן |
ההגדרה הזו קובעת את העיכוב המינימלי בין הפעלות של תהליכי רקע לצורך תחזוקה אוטומטית של אינדקס וקטורי. ערך ברירת המחדל הוא 1 דקות.
scann.max_allowed_num_levels
| סוג | integer |
| ברירת מחדל | 2 |
| ערך מינימלי | 1 |
| ערך מקסימלי | 3 |
| הפעלה מחדש של מכונה | לא |
הערך הזה קובע את הערך הכי גבוה שאפשר להגדיר ל-max_num_levels כשיוצרים אינדקס ScaNN.
parameterized_views.enabled
| סוג | boolean |
| ברירת מחדל | off |
| הפעלה מחדש של מכונה | כן |
המדיניות הזו קובעת אם התכונות של תצוגה עם פרמטרים מופעלות.
ההגדרה של הדגל parameterized_views.enabled לא משוכפלת באופן אוטומטי, וצריך לשכפל אותה באופן ידני בכל מופע. צריך להפעיל את הדגל parameterized_views.enabled בכל מופע משוכפל לפני שמבצעים שאילתות בתצוגות מאופשרות פרמטרים בשכפול. מידע נוסף זמין במאמר ניהול אבטחת נתוני אפליקציות באמצעות תצוגות מאובטחות עם פרמטרים ב-AlloyDB Omni.
parameterized_views.json_results_max_rows
| סוג | integer |
| ברירת מחדל | 1,000,000 |
| הפעלה מחדש של מכונה | לא |
ההגדרה קובעת את המספר המקסימלי של שורות בתוצאות JSON מהפונקציה execute_parameterized_query().
parameterized_views.json_results_max_size
| סוג | integer |
| ברירת מחדל | 1,048,576 |
| הפעלה מחדש של מכונה | לא |
ההגדרה קובעת את הגודל המקסימלי של תוצאות JSON בקילובייטים (KB) מהפונקציה execute_parameterized_query().
parameterized_views.max_parallel_workers_per_gather
| סוג | integer |
| ברירת מחדל | -1 |
| הפעלה מחדש של מכונה | לא |
מגדיר את המספר המקסימלי של תהליכים מקבילים לכל צומת של מנוע ההפעלה כשמריצים שאילתה באמצעות API של תצוגות עם פרמטרים. -1 מציין שאין מגבלה. המגבלה הזו חלה רק אם היא מגבילה יותר מהמגבלה max_parallel_workers_per_gather.
parameterized_views.statement_timeout
| סוג | integer |
| ברירת מחדל | 0 |
| הפעלה מחדש של מכונה | לא |
מגדיר את משך הזמן המקסימלי המותר באלפיות השנייה של הצהרות שמופעלות באמצעות parameterized views API. הערך 0 מציין שאין מגבלה. המגבלה הזו חלה רק אם היא מגבילה יותר מהערך statement_timeout.
parameterized_views.temp_file_limit
| סוג | integer |
| ברירת מחדל | -1 |
| הפעלה מחדש של מכונה | לא |
מגביל את הגודל הכולל בקילו-בייט של כל הקבצים הזמניים שמשמשים כל תהליך כשמריצים אותו באמצעות parameterized views API. -1 מציין שאין הגבלה. ההגבלה הזו חלה רק אם היא מגבילה יותר מ-temp_file_limit.
parameterized_views.work_mem
| סוג | integer |
| ברירת מחדל | 0 |
| הפעלה מחדש של מכונה | לא |
מגדיר את הזיכרון המקסימלי ב-kB שייעשה בו שימוש בסביבות עבודה של שאילתות כשהן מופעלות באמצעות parameterized views API. 0 מציין שאין מגבלה. המגבלה הזו חלה רק אם היא מגבילה יותר מהמגבלה work_mem.
vector_assist.enabled
| סוג | boolean |
| ברירת מחדל | on |
| הפעלה מחדש של מכונה | לא |
המדיניות קובעת אם התכונות של עזרה וקטורית מופעלות.